The problem with so much of alt. rock's use of fascism as some kind of shock tactic is actually how safe it is. We live in a liberal society where such gestures are ultimately tolerated (albeit reluctantly and at times with some opposition) There are now far greater social taboos than National Socialism, which has become little more than a distant symbol of evil or 'wrongness' in most parts of the world - at least those parts of the world where this type of music tends to be created (America, Britain and Central Europe, Japan, etc.). You only have to look at the current moral outrage in Britain surrounding the whole 'Madelaine' saga to see that the swastika is, by comparison, a fairly minor source of anxiety in most people's lives.
